Instructions
 

Preparation

  • Wash the green beans thoroughly under running water and pat them dry with a clean kitchen towel. Trim the ends of the beans.

Coating the Green Beans

  • In a large mixing bowl, combine the green beans, refined flour, salt, and black pepper (if using). Toss gently to coat the beans evenly, ensuring they are mostly dry. Excess moisture will prevent crisping.

Frying the Green Beans

  • Heat the vegetable oil in a wok or large pan over medium-high heat. Once the oil is hot (a pinch of flour should sizzle immediately), carefully add the green beans in batches, ensuring not to overcrowd the pan. Fry until golden brown and crispy, about 4-5 minutes per batch. Remove the fried green beans and place them on a paper towel-lined plate to drain excess oil.

Mixing with Schezwan Sauce

  • Transfer the crispy green beans to a mixing bowl. Add the Schezwan sauce and toss gently to coat all the beans evenly.

Serving

  • Serve immediately and enjoy your delicious Crispy Fried Schezwan Green Beans!

Recipe Notes

Expert Tips for Perfect Schezwan Green Beans

  • For extra crispy green beans, double-fry them. Fry once until partially cooked, then remove, let cool slightly, and fry again until golden and extra crispy.
  • Adjust the amount of Schezwan sauce according to your spice preference. Start with less and add more if needed.
  • Don't overcrowd the pan when frying. Work in batches to ensure even cooking and crisping.
  • For a more complex flavor profile, consider adding a pinch of garlic powder or onion powder to the flour coating.
